| 668476 | 2008-05-12 03:34:00 | Have loaded XP service pack 3 and on boot up I am getting two dialogue boxes referring to wlanapi.dll I click the boxes "öut"and there doesn't seem to be any problem with the rest of the boot up and operation. Ideas for a cure of this annoyance would be appreciated. Googling only seems to refer to a vista problem with this and I am not going there! Thanks Running XP Home S/pack 3 loaded |

| 668477 | 2008-05-12 03:35:00 | Sounds like a driver file for a wireless LAN device is conflicting with something, as a guess. Do you have wi-fi on this PC? Try uninstalling the device and looking for updated drivers, if you do. |
